District Metals (TSX.V:DMX - OTCQB:DMXCF - Nasdaq First North:DMXSE SDB) has secured its largest financing to date - a fully subscribed $6 million private placement, priced at $0.27 per share under the LIFE (Listed Issuer Financing Exemption) offering.
President and CEO Garrett Ainsworth joins me to provide insights into the raise, investor interest, and how this funding strengthens District’s position heading into a critical phase of uranium exploration in Sweden.
Key topics discussed include:
Upcoming catalyst: Judicial review of uranium moratorium legislation expected in May; Swedish Parliament vote in September 2025, airborne geophysics on the uranium projects.
